About Geladandong Ice Field in Amdo County, Nagqu

Geladandong Ice Field is located in Mafei Jiri Village(玛飞吉日乡) of Amdo County, Nagqu. Geladandong Ice Field is one of the largest ice fields in central Qinghai-Tibetan Plateau, also the water source of Yangtze River, Selin Co Lake and Chibozhang Co Lake.  At the foot of Geladandong Mountain, with an area of eight hundred square kilometers, there are seracs(冰塔) known as Gangjiaqiaoba(岗加巧巴).  The shapes of these seracs are different. However, the most interesting thing in the ice forest is the seven color light. There is a break in the ice seracs forest and seven color light flashing from the crack. These colorful lights give a sparkle to the smoky air and attract thousands of tourists to visit here.
